2017-03-16 119 views

回答

0

你有下面的步骤来采取:

  1. 我假设你已经创建了邮件黑猩猩邮件模板
  2. 我使用的山魈通过邮件黑猩猩来发送邮件。在代码的顶部安装节点包管理山魈-API

    npm install mandrill-api

  3. 呼叫包

    var mandrill = require('mandrill-api/mandrill'); var mandrill_client = new mandrill.Mandrill('YOUR_API_KEY');

  4. 在你的方法定义的消息变量 var message = { "from_email": send_as_email, "from_name": send_as_name, "merge_language": "mailchimp", "global_merge_vars": null };

    message.to = [{ "email":'SENDER_EMAIL', "name":'SENDER_NAME', "type": "to" }];

    message.subject ='SUBJECT OF MAIL'; mandrill_client.messages.sendTemplate({ "template_name":'NAME_OF_MAILCHIMP_TEMPLATE', "template_content": null, "message": message }, function (result) { //DO ON RESPONSE }, function (e) { //TRACE Your Error });

+0

这是一个很好的答案。我很想知道如何使用PHP来做同样的事情。有任何想法吗? –

+0

我们可以使用html而不是模板名称吗? –

相关问题